To print any character in the Python interpreter, use a \u to denote a unicode character and then follow with the character code. SymPy is a Python library for symbolic mathematics. from sympy import Symbol, symbols X = Symbol('X') expression = X + X + 1 print(expression) a, b, c = symbols('a, b, c') expression = a*b + b*a + a*c + c*a print(expression) with the output: 2*X + 1 2*a*b + 2*a*c We alredy see simplification for basic expresssion.
